Product Description

It is a brand new analog synthesizer with Novations 'acid' filter joining the 'classic' original bass filter from the Bass Station using a brand new analog synth called Novation Bass Station.
64 factory patches and 64 user slots are included in the package
The sequencer uses pattern variables and has two oscillators and additional sub oscillators
A dedicated controller for every major parameter is available in an analog synth layout
A separate filter overdrive to add an aggressive, crunchy quality to the sound. Includes full analog distortion and filter-modulation effects. This, as well as all other Novation products, are now covered under the 3-Year Warranty.
